using System;
using System.Runtime.InteropServices;
#if UNITY_2018_1_OR_NEWER
using Unity.Collections;
using Unity.Collections.LowLevel.Unsafe;
#endif
namespace SQLite
{
public static class SQLiteConnectionExtensions
{
public static byte[] Serialize(this SQLiteConnection db, string schema = null)
{
IntPtr buffer = SQLite3.Serialize(db.Handle, schema, out long size, SQLite3.SerializeFlags.None);
if (buffer == IntPtr.Zero)
{
return null;
}
try
{
var bytes = new byte[size];
Marshal.Copy(buffer, bytes, 0, (int) size);
return bytes;
}
finally
{
SQLite3.Free(buffer);
}
}
public static SQLiteConnection Deserialize(this SQLiteConnection db, byte[] buffer, string schema = null, SQLite3.DeserializeFlags flags = SQLite3.DeserializeFlags.None)
{
return Deserialize(db, buffer, buffer.LongLength, schema, flags);
}
public static SQLiteConnection Deserialize(this SQLiteConnection db, byte[] buffer, long usedSize, string schema = null, SQLite3.DeserializeFlags flags = SQLite3.DeserializeFlags.None)
{
SQLite3.Result result = SQLite3.Deserialize(db.Handle, schema, buffer, usedSize, buffer.LongLength, flags);
if (result != SQLite3.Result.OK)
{
throw SQLiteException.New(result, SQLite3.GetErrmsg(db.Handle));
}
return db;
}
#if UNITY_2018_1_OR_NEWER
public static SQLiteConnection Deserialize(this SQLiteConnection db, NativeArray<byte> buffer, string schema = null, SQLite3.DeserializeFlags flags = SQLite3.DeserializeFlags.None)
{
return Deserialize(db, buffer, buffer.Length, schema, flags);
}
public static SQLiteConnection Deserialize(this SQLiteConnection db, NativeArray<byte> buffer, long usedSize, string schema = null, SQLite3.DeserializeFlags flags = SQLite3.DeserializeFlags.None)
{
SQLite3.Result result;
unsafe
{
result = SQLite3.Deserialize(db.Handle, schema, buffer.GetUnsafePtr(), usedSize, buffer.Length, flags);
}
if (result != SQLite3.Result.OK)
{
throw SQLiteException.New(result, SQLite3.GetErrmsg(db.Handle));
}
return db;
}
#endif
#if UNITY_2021_2_OR_NEWER
public static SQLiteConnection Deserialize(this SQLiteConnection db, ReadOnlySpan<byte> buffer, string schema = null, SQLite3.DeserializeFlags flags = SQLite3.DeserializeFlags.None)
{
return Deserialize(db, buffer, buffer.Length, schema, flags);
}
public static SQLiteConnection Deserialize(this SQLiteConnection db, ReadOnlySpan<byte> buffer, long usedSize, string schema = null, SQLite3.DeserializeFlags flags = SQLite3.DeserializeFlags.None)
{
SQLite3.Result result;
unsafe
{
fixed (void* ptr = buffer)
{
result = SQLite3.Deserialize(db.Handle, schema, ptr, usedSize, buffer.Length, flags);
}
}
if (result != SQLite3.Result.OK)
{
throw SQLiteException.New(result, SQLite3.GetErrmsg(db.Handle));
}
return db;
}
#endif
}
}
